How Large Will My Dumpster Need to Be for My Project in Eugene?

10 Yard Dumpster

10 yard dumpster in Eugene

10 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 4 pick-up trucks of waste material. These dumpsters are most often used for smaller projects such as garage/basement clean outs, small bathroom remodels, kitchen remodels, small roof replacements up to 1500 sq ft or a small deck removal up to 500 sq ft.

20 Yard Dumpster

20 yard dumpster in Eugene

20 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 8 pick-up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for projects like flooring or carpet removal for a large house, roof replacements up to 3,000 sq ft, deck removal up to 400 sq ft, or large garage/basement clean outs.

30 Yard Dumpster

30 yard dumpster in Eugene

30 yard roll off dumpsters hold about 12 pick up trucks of waste material. They are most often used for projects like new home constructions, large home additions, siding or window replacements for a small to medium sized house, or garage/basement demolition.

40 Yard Dumpster

40 yard dumpster in Eugene

40 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 16 pick up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for large projects like commercial clean outs, window replacement or siding for a large home, large home renovations, large construction projects, or large commercial roofing projects.

Although it’s always a good idea to describe your project in detail when renting a dumpster so we can help you select a proper size, below are some examples of typical jobs and the average sized dumpster you’ll want to rent.

The following are the most frequent projects our customers need a dumpster for and the suggested sizes to rent:

Remodeling or Waste Removal: In general, a 20 cubic yard dumpster is perfect for remodeling a single room in your house, or performing a basic cleanup. This size dumpster can carry around six truckloads of trash, which is generally more than enough, but you may need a bigger one for rooms with a lot of cabinets or appliances to dispose of.

Multi-Room Contracting Jobs: If you have more than one room you’re going to be working on, then it’s a good idea to upgrade to a 30 cubic yard dumpster size. This permits for a greater volume of trash to be easily disposed of and will guarantee you don’t need a number of trips to dispose of it.

Basement, Garage or Attic Cleanups: It’s a good idea to clear out unnecessary items from your home’s storage areas to free up more space. For the average home storage area, a simple 10 or 15 cubic yard dumpster is best. If you have sizeable items, such as appliances, you may want a 20 yarder just to be on the safe side.

Full Home Cleanout Projects: If you’re performing a home cleanup and are doing away with furniture items, then you’ll likely want a 15 to 20 cubic yard dumpster rental for the regular sized home. Much bigger homes, however, could benefit from working with a 30 cubic yard dumpster to handle all the unwanted items you’re getting rid of.

Landscaping Projects: Landscaping, yard or gardening jobs usually only produce a small amount of waste that will not take up a substantial amount of space in a dumpster. Therefore, the common yard project will only require a 10 to 15 cubic yard dumpster, unless you are considering disposing of a lot of tree branches or full shrubbery.

Construction Work: The best dumpster rental solution for contracting work or large scale projects would be the 40 cubic yard option. Anytime you expect a large amount of debris to be produced by your job, having a greater sized dumpster is the safest bet. Heavy waste objects, such as concrete or asphalt, will require a specific heavy-duty dumpster.

What Can I Expect to Spend on a Dumpster Rental in Eugene?

Generally,you can expect to pay around $185 to $1,000 for a roll-off dumpster rental in Eugene. Dumpsters for rent in Eugene can vary in fees based on variety of factors.

One of the largest factors you need to think about is the size of the bin. You must plan which type of bin to get so you can avoid paying excessive rental fees. For small types of bins, you can expect to pay around $200. If you require a larger dumpster, you may spend close to $1000. Most rental companies include the travel costs into the final bill without you even knowing. Always verify the final rates with the provider before handing over your hard earned cash.

In this section, we’ll look at the standard costs of renting a dumpster, which mostly depends on the container’s size, types of debris, and length of time.

Cost of your dumpster rental might also be impacted by the following:

– Total weight of the waste.
– Waste that would be regarded as hazardous materials.
– Landfill fees on particular goods such as appliances or large furniture.
– Exceeding your chosen dumpster’s weight limit.
– Perhaps needing to acquire municipal permits for your area.
– Trying to keep the dumpster for longer than the initial rental period.

Should I Apply for a Permit for My Dumpster Rental in Eugene?

For most customers in the Eugene area getting a permit for a dumpster rental placement will not be a problem. In general, a permit won’t be required as long as you are able to position the dumpster on your own private property, such as your driveway or other location you own. Only when you find yourself wanting to place the dumpster on public property, such as sidewalks or parking areas on the side of the road, that certain municipalities require permits issued.

There is a Public Works Department located in your local Eugene municipality that is responsible for issuing different permits, including ones for placing dumpsters on public property. Once you get in contact with them they will present you with the appropriate application form, or you can normally just visit their website. After you fill out the brief form, simply submit it to the office. This can take place either in person, online or over the phone. These applications should be authorized within 24 business hours, so you won’t have to wait long and it shouldn’t hold up your task. How much your permit will cost you depends on where you’re placing it, the type of project you’re performing and how long it will sit on public property for.
